Proctor queue (Quillgate): if exam-session jobs back up past 500, check the snapshot worker first — it deadlocks on oversized webcam blobs. Drain with the requeue script, never purge; sessions must replay in order. Escalate if lag exceeds 15 minutes. The full drain procedure is documented on this page.

runbook for tafof-yawif: https://confluence.tolvaqsys.internal/display/display/browse/pages/7be3

## Webhook Retry Semantics — Pindrop Relay

Deliveries retry on 5xx and timeouts only. Backoff: exponential, capped at 15 minutes, max 8 attempts. 4xx responses are terminal. Retries reuse the original payload; receivers must dedupe by event key. Retry state lives in the relay, not the sender. All provenance questions start with the trace token recorded below.

trace token, fafog-kageg: htk4_98e6

Handover Note — Fixturesmith Test-Data Factory

To whoever picks this up from me (likely Darya on the Copperlane team): the Fixturesmith library now seeds deterministic fixtures for all plugin sandboxes. Plugin authors should call the factory builder, never instantiate records directly — the referential integrity checks depend on it. The nightly seed job runs under a locked maintenance account. If you ever need to rotate its credentials or unlock the sandbox vault manually, the recovery passphrase you'll need is below.

strongbox words: fraath-isteth

## Deploying the Gatewick Proctor Queue

Deploys are pretty painless: push to main, wait for the pipeline, then watch the queue drain dashboard for five minutes. If candidates pile up mid-exam, roll back first and ask questions later — the queue replays safely. Everything the workers care about lives in one config block, shown here for reference.

settings of bafof-yagef:
JOROX_PIN=8740
JOROX_TENANT=pelox
JOROX_METRICS_HOST=metrics.jorox.qorvelworks.internal
JOROX_SEAL=seal_c78f63c1
JOROX_STANDBY_TEAM=norax